
After first use, Fiery Remote Scan automatically attempts to connect to the last Fiery ES used in the previous session.
You can immediately start to retrieve any scans initiated at the printer control panel, and use
Fiery Remote Scan
Help
.
Instructions for configuring and modifying the connection to the Fiery ES are also provided in
Fiery Remote Scan
Help
.
1
Open Fiery Remote Scan.
2
Click the
Choose a Fiery
icon (magnifying glass) to open the
Connect to Server
dialog box.
3
Type the name or IP address in the
Connect to a server
field.
If you do not have the name or IP address, see
4
Click the plus sign icon to add it to the server list.
When you click the plus sign, you add the Fiery ES to the list, but do not connect to it. This operation is useful
when you want to add more than one Fiery ES in a session. You can then switch between any Fiery ES in the
Fiery
Remote Scan
window without opening the
Connect to Server
dialog box.
5
Click
Connect
or
Cancel
.
Clicking
Connect
adds the Fiery ES to the list at the same time as connecting to it. If the connection was
successful, the
Fiery Remote Scan
window opens.
If you clicked
Cancel
, all operations that you did to add or remove the Fiery ES are cancelled. Any server list
changes are discarded.
If you do not have the specific name or IP address of the Fiery ES, you can search by IP ranges or by subnet.
To perform an advanced search
You can search for a Fiery ES in different ways.
1
In the
Connect to Server
dialog box, click the Choose a Fiery icon (magnifying glass) to open the
Search
dialog
box.
2
Select
Auto Search
or select
IP Range
or
Subnet
to specify the range to search, and then click
Go
.
Any available Fiery ES that matches the search criteria is shown. You can filter the search result list by typing a
keyword in the
Filter by keyword
field.
3
Select the Fiery ES from the results list and click
Add
.
4
To add another Fiery ES to the list for later use, click the plus sign in the
Connect to Server
dialog box.
5
In the
Connect to Server
dialog box, click
Connect
to add the Fiery ES to
My Fiery List
and connect to it.
If you clicked
Connect
and the connection was successful, the
Fiery Remote Scan
window opens.
If you clicked
Cancel
, all operations that you did to add or remove any Fiery ES are canceled. Any server list
changes are discarded.
